January 17, 2019 As the prizes of the offseason, Bryce Harper and Manny Machado have yet to sign contracts, Goold says there have been a plethora of pleas from Cardinals nation in his Twitter mentions and emails begging for St. Louis to cash out and sign Harper. Although Goold has no pull in the front office, he had an opinion about the 26-year-old who's been expected to sign a record-breaking deal this offseason.
